Mock react component
To mock a React component within Jest you should use the `jest.mock` function. The file that exports the specific component is mocked and replaced with a custom implementation. Since a component is essentially a function, the mock should also return a function. Leading on from the example above, the … Meer weergeven There are two components, TopLevelComponent and Modal. The TopLevelComponent can take a prop of open. When open is set to true the Modal is shown. The … Meer weergeven The above example uses a default exported function. It is the main item to be exported from its file. However, how do we mock the … Meer weergeven I have written another piece on that over at: Check React Component Props are Passed to Child in Jest Unit Test. That shows how to … Meer weergeven Web24 sep. 2024 · First, to mock a component you use jest.mock ("path/to/RealComponent") . You can specify an mock implementation inline like jest.mock ("../src/Icon" () => { ... }) . …
Mock react component
Did you know?
WebJest Mocking — Part 4: React Component In this article series, we will take a look at how to mock with Jest. Jest Mocking — Part 1: Function Jest Mocking — Part 2: Module … Web20 mei 2024 · How to mock react components with react testing library? import {Child1} from './child1'; import {Child2} from './child2'; ... return ( <> ) I'm …
Web23 apr. 2024 · Three steps to mock an import: 1) Import what you need as a module object: import * as FooModule from '../relative/path/to/foo'; 2) Tell Jest to watch the path to that … Web18 apr. 2024 · Without mocking the react-json-view library above, we wouldn’t have a straightforward way of checking whether our component rendered it when using React …
Web12 apr. 2024 · Storybook, a tool for building and documenting UI components, has become integral to the creation and maintenance of component libraries—and design systems. Because Storybook offers an interface for non-developers, allowing anyone to explore, play with and manipulate the components and documentation, it’s perfect for collaboration. Web[英]Jest mock is not being called when testing a react component Brad McAllister 2024-02-09 16:43:17 1546 1 reactjs / unit-testing / mocking / jestjs / enzyme
Web30 mei 2024 · Mocking helps us remove complicated external functionality which is otherwise not relevant to the functionality that we might want to test out inside of a React component (which helps keep our tests light, and easier to read and understand - because mocking (module rewiring) can save us from needing a slew of cy.intercept () calls in the …
WebCheck React-jsx-mock 0.1.1 package - Last release 0.1.1 with MIT licence at our NPM packages aggregator and search ... Weekly downloads-License. MIT. Repository-Last … black and white rainbow high dollWebSnapshot Testing with Mocks, Enzyme and React 16+ There's a caveat around snapshot testing when using Enzyme and React 16+. If you mock out a module using the following style: jest.mock('../SomeDirectory/SomeComponent', () => 'SomeComponent'); Then you will see warnings in the console: Warning: is using uppercase HTML. gahanna jefferson new high schoolWeb2 dagen geleden ·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ams black and white raiders logoWeb1 aug. 2024 · Mock Loadable at your test case, i.e., jest.mock('../Loadable', () => { return function({ loader }) { loader(); return function LoadableComponent() { return null; }; }; }); Now you can use 'LoadableComponent' to find the lazy-loaded component. i.e., expect(component.find('LoadableComponent').exists()).toEqual(true); gahanna jefferson schools athleticsWeb3 jul. 2024 · Flexible yet type-safe mocks that work for any function including React components. Summary: jest.mock covers many use cases jest.MockedFunction is the best for type-safe mock functions Don't be afraid to mock React components they are just functions! Take care, Rupert Library versions used when … gahanna jefferson school district numberWeb13 feb. 2024 · Advanced React Component Mocks with Jest and React Testing Library I am a huge fan of Jest and React Testing Library. When learning these tools, something … black and white rainbow photoWeb8 sep. 2024 · To mock a React module we use jest.mock (path). This is called an automatic mock. It automatically mocks the component. You can access this mock by simply calling it's name after you imported it. This is the definitive test for our ParentComponent: gahanna jefferson public schools ohio